Students of the Master's program Cybernetics and Robotics will acquire advanced knowledge of cybernetics, robotics, automatic control, diagnostics, and sensors in the compulsory subjects of the program and will also develop their creative engineering skills in the subjects of project type. Students study the general field called Cybernetics and Robotics and can choose courses from four available specializations. However, they are still able to gain an insight into other sectors of the program by selecting a required elective course (this is a denoted as a compulsory subject in one of four specializations), and also by the choice of their optional courses.

On the other hand, students of a general field - deliberately named the same way as the course itself - can direct their way through the program according to their own needs, by choosing their required elective courses in a so to speak zigzag manner - out of the compulsory subjects for all specializations. Thus, while maintaining the depth of knowledge in some areas, our students are also able to broaden their horizons in other fields, which helps them in their future career and opens them the doors to the rest of the world.

Continuity with the bachelor's program

The Master's course is loosely based on the undergraduate program Cybernetics and robotics, but it is open to graduates from other programs, faculties, and schools. A completed bachelor's degree in any program of a similar focus is the main requirement. Any lack of knowledge of students coming from other faculties or universities can be supplemented by elective courses during the first year of the program. This is thanks to the variety of available elective subjects. None of the fields requires specialization in the previous bachelor's course.
